Fatty Acids Test
This test is used in the
diagnosis and management of certain diseases and disorders of metabolism and
in the evaluation of prospective causes of hyperlipoproteinemia. A disorder
of disease that causes excessive release of a lipoactive hormone (epinephrine,
ACTH, GH, etc) can induce an elevation of blood level of fatty acids. A sustained
release of fatty acids from adipose cells in excess of energy needs can contribute
to the development of secondary hyperlipoproteinemia.
A significant deviation
from the normal range may require further evaluation by your physician.
